Arenillas, Soria, Spain

Overview

Arenillas is a tiny, tranquil village in Soria province, Spain, known for its centuries-old buildings and serene rural charm. With a close-knit population and peaceful surroundings, it offers an authentic glimpse into traditional Castilian village life.

Best Time to Visit

May to September for the warmest, sunniest weather and local festivities.

Local Tips

Shops and cafes may have limited hours, especially afternoons; plan meals and essentials ahead. Public transport is minimal, renting a car is recommended.

Cultural Etiquette

Greet locals with a friendly 'hola'; casual, modest dress is appropriate. Tipping isn't compulsory but rounding up the bill or leaving small change is appreciated.

Safety Warnings

Arenillas is very safe; take basic countryside precautions such as checking for ticks after nature walks and staying on marked paths.

Hidden Gems

Seek out the 13th-century San Pedro church, enjoy star-gazing due to minimal light pollution, and explore walking routes to nearby abandoned villages.
